Real-time applications are the backbone of modern interactive services. Whether it’s a chat application, live notifications, or collaborative tools, WebSockets provide a full-duplex communication channel between the client and the server. Nginx, a powerful and high-performance web server, can be configured to act as a reverse proxy with WebSocket support, facilitating these real-time interactions efficiently. In this article, we’ll explore the benefits of using Nginx for WebSocket connections and provide a step-by-step guide suitable even for newcomers.
Benefits of Using Nginx for WebSocket Connections
- Performance: Nginx is known for its high performance and low memory footprint.
- Scalability: Easily scale your application to handle more connections without significant changes to the architecture.
- Security: Nginx allows you to centralize your security policies, such as SSL/TLS encryption, in one place.
- Flexibility: Proxy WebSocket traffic along with HTTP and HTTPS traffic without needing additional servers.
Setting Up Nginx with WebSocket Support
Before configuring Nginx to support WebSocket connections, you will need to have Nginx installed on your server. This guide assumes you have Nginx installed and a basic understanding of its configuration file structure.
Step 1: Basic Nginx Configuration for Proxying
To start, configure your Nginx server block to proxy HTTP connections to your WebSocket server (which is often also an HTTP server). Here’s a basic example:
http {
map $http_upgrade $connection_upgrade {
default upgrade;
'' close;
}
server {
listen 80;
server_name example.com;
location / {
proxy_pass http://localhost:3000;
proxy_http_version 1.1;
proxy_set_header Upgrade $http_upgrade;
proxy_set_header Connection $connection_upgrade;
proxy_set_header Host $host;
}
}
}
Replace example.com
with your domain and http://localhost:3000
with the URL of your WebSocket server.
Step 2: Enabling SSL/TLS
For secure WebSocket connections (wss://
), you’ll need to enable SSL/TLS in your Nginx configuration:
server {
listen 443 ssl;
server_name example.com;
ssl_certificate /path/to/your/fullchain.pem;
ssl_certificate_key /path/to/your/privkey.pem;
# ... the rest of your configuration as above ...
}
Replace the paths with the actual paths to your SSL certificate files.
Step 3: Testing the Configuration
After making these changes, test your Nginx configuration for syntax errors:
nginx -t
If the test is successful, reload Nginx to apply the changes:
systemctl reload nginx
or
nginx -s reload
Step 4: Monitoring and Troubleshooting
Monitor your Nginx access and error logs for any issues:
tail -f /var/log/nginx/access.log
tail -f /var/log/nginx/error.log
If you encounter problems, these logs can provide insight into what may be going wrong.
